Razor wire, often mistaken for barbed wire, features sharper, interlocking blades designed to inflict serious cuts upon anyone attempting to breach the barrier. Its intimidating appearance alone serves as a powerful deterrent. Homeowners, businesses, and government facilities leverage this tool to reinforce their security strategies, making unauthorized access exceptionally challenging. Expertise in Design and Material

Razor wire is crafted from high-tensile steel, ensuring durability and resistance to the elements. Its design, a series of sharp-edged strips, maximizes the difficulty of cutting through with tools, unlike traditional fencing materials. For residential use, low-profile razor wire segments can blend with garden aesthetics without overwhelming the surroundings, while still providing robust protection. In contrast, commercial and industrial settings may use more obtrusive coils, emphasizing security over subtlety. The type of razor wire chosen can impact its performance and lifespan. Galvanized or stainless steel options offer varying levels of rust resistance and strength, influencing maintenance schedules and costs. Understanding these material differences is crucial for consumers in making informed purchasing decisions, aligning with both their security needs and budgetary constraints. Experience-Driven Insights Users of razor wire often share practical tips from personal experience that can enhance its effectiveness. For example, combining razor wire with motion sensors or security cameras can create a layered defense, thwarting even the most determined intruders. Regular inspections to check for damage or wear, especially after severe weather, ensure that the razor wire remains in optimal condition. Additionally, the visual impact of razor wire cannot be overstated. Its presence alone can cause potential intruders to reconsider an attempted breach, reducing the likelihood of escalation and confrontation. This passive security feature allows property owners to maintain a protective stance without active monitoring. Installation Considerations Installing razor wire requires careful planning and execution to maximize its security potential without compromising safety. It is crucial to assess the specific needs of the property, considering factors such as terrain, existing structures, and the nature of potential threats. Engaging a professional installer can mitigate risks associated with improper setup, such as injury or inadequate coverage. The height of the fence and the layering of the razor wire can further refine its deterrence capability. Multiple horizontal rows or a spiraling layout can cover vulnerabilities that may otherwise be exploited. Proper installation ensures that razor wire serves as a long-term security investment rather than a temporary fix.
